Dr. Armstrong said violently: «We must get out of here – we must – we must! At all costs!»

Mr. Justice Wargrave looked thoughtfully out of the smoking-room window. He played with the cord of his eye-glasses. He said:

«I do not, of course, profess to be a weather prophet. But I should say that it is very unlikely that a boat could reach us – even if they knew of our plight – under twenty-four hours – and even then only if the wind drops.»

Dr. Armstrong dropped his head in his hands and groaned.

He said: «And in the meantime we may all be murdered in our beds?»

«I hope not,» said Mr. Justice Wargrave. «I intend to take every possible precaution against such a thing happening.»

It flashed across Dr. Armstrong’s mind that an old man like the judge, was far more tenacious of life than a younger man would be. He had often marvelled at that fact in his professional career. Here was he, junior to the judge by perhaps twenty years, and yet with a vastly inferior sense of self-preservation.

Mr. Justice Wargrave was thinking:

«Murdered in our beds! These doctors are all the same – they think in clichiis. A thoroughly commonplace mind.»

The doctor said: «There have been three victims already, remember.»

«Certainly. But you must remember that they were unprepared for the attack. We are forewarned.»

Dr. Armstrong said bitterly: «What can we do? Sooner or later —»

«I think,» said Mr. Justice Wargrave, «that there are several things we can do.»

Armstrong said: «We’ve no idea, even, who it can be —»

The judge stroked his chin and murmured:

«Oh, you know, I wouldn’t quite say that.»

Armstrong stared at him.

«Do you mean you know?»

Mr. Justice Wargrave said cautiously: «As regards actual evidence, such as is necessary in court, I admit that I have none. But it appears to me, reviewing the whole business, that one particular person is sufficiently clearly indicated. Yes, I think so.»

Armstrong stared at him.

He said: «I don’t understand.»
